1. During non-handoff operations, a method for communicating between a base station and an individual remote terminal of a CDMA-based communications network, comprising the steps of:

  • (a) communicating between the base station and the individual remote terminal via a first subset of types of CDMA channels at a first sectorization level of a cell-site sectorization scheme; and

    (b) simultaneously communicating between the base station and the individual remote terminal via a second subset of types of CDMA channels, different from the first subset, at a second sectorization level of the cell-site sectorization scheme, having a degree of sectorization different from the degree of sectorization of the first sectorization level, wherein;

    a cell corresponding to the base station is simultaneously sectorized at (1) the first sectorization level for communications between the base station and the individual remote terminal using the first subset of types of CDMA channels and (2) the second sectorization level for communications between the base station and the individual remote terminal using the second subset of types of CDMA channels;

    the types of CDMA channels comprise one or more of pilot, sync, paging, and forward link traffic channels transmitted from the base station to the remote terminal, and one or more of access and reverse link traffic channels transmitted from the remote terminal to the base station;

    the first subset comprises one or more of the pilot and sync channels; and

    the second subset comprises one or more of the access, paging, forward link traffic, and reverse link traffic channels.
